I am already spending a few hours on using Clientvariables and I am not able to
get them to work. When I try to access the Client scope like this
cfif StructKeyExists(arguments.loginData,"rememberLogin")>
<cfset client.logindata.email="#arguments.loginData.email#">
<cfset client.logindata.password="#arguments.loginData.password#">
</cfif>
I get an error
"Error Messages: The requested scope client has not been enabled.
Before client variables can be used, the client state management system must be
enabled using the cfapplication tag."
pointing to the line with
<cfset client.logindata.email="#arguments.loginData.email#">
Here's what I did to get client variables to work:
In phpMyAdmin I created a database 'client_variables' with fields
cdata & cglobal (specifics about the db here:
http://livedocs.adobe.com/coldfusion/8/htmldocs/help.html?content=sharedVars_08.html);
In the CFAdministrator under Data & Services I created a datasource pointing to
this db;
In the CFAdministrator under Server settings / Client variables I selected
"client_variables" under "Select Data Source to Add as Client Store" and
clicked "Add";
Under "Server Settings > Client Variables" / "Select Default Storage Mechanism
for Client Sessions" I choose the newly added datasource client_variables.
That should be it.
Now after the first error message I got I _also_ added this line to the
Application.cfc in my webroot:
<cfset this.clientManagement="true">
This made no difference. Using <cfapplication clientmanagement="true"> also
made no difference. I restarted the CF server and Apache several times in the
process though I don't think that should be necessary. Here I'm running out of
options.
